Service Objectives
To assist children and youth to enhance their abilities to solve problems encountered in families, schools, socialisation and so on; to develop positive behaviour and values; to arouse the community’s concern on the needs and challenges which the youth are facing so as to build up a favourable social environment.
Target Group and Scopes of Service
Target Group
Needy children and youth aged from 6 to 24 in the local community
Scopes of Service
Through the outreaching service, establish contact with the children and youth in need.
Individual and group counselling: through interviews, home visits and counselling, guidance to help the development of children and youth.
Special programmes and projects: skills training, life planning and life experience.
Crisis intervention.
Facilities and Fees
Facilities
Activity room, interview room, TV games, and chess games
Fees
Guidance and counselling are free of charge. Programmes will be charged depending on the nature of activities.
Application Procedures and Withdrawal Procedures
Application Procedures
Apply through social workers, or referred by organisations, schools, parents or individuals.
Withdrawal Procedures
Submit your request through social workers
